Three Teams Tie for 2025 Philadelphia PGA Spring Pro-Pro Championship Title
Northfield, N.J. (April 28, 2025) — On a brilliant, sunny day, three teams of PGA of America Golf Professionals, Applebrook Golf Club’s Dave McNabb and Overbrook Golf Club’s Eric Kennedy, John F. Byrne Golf Course’s Anthony Hoffman and Rocco Sgrillo, and Doylestown Country Club’s Patrick Shine and Anthony Bonargo, tied atop the leaderboard for the 2025 Philadelphia PGA Spring Pro-Pro Championship title at Atlantic City Country Club.
All three teams finished their rounds with 8-under-par 62s in the 18-hole Four-Ball format. Three more teams finished in a tie for fourth place, one stroke behind the victors: Merion G.C.’s Matthew Durham and Pine Valley G.C.’s Matt Zehner; DuPont C.C.’s Michael Caldwell and Matt Finger; and Wilmington C.C.’s Bob Lennon and Ryan Rucinski.

About the Philadelphia PGA Section
The Philadelphia PGA Section, covering eastern Pennsylvania, southern New Jersey and Delaware, is one of 41 geographical managing entities of the PGA of America. This Section manages nearly 900 PGA of America Members and Associates who are employed at over 590 golf facilities in our region.
